About Stephen M. Saunders
Stephen M. Saunders is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Applied Psychology, General Psychology, Social Psychology and Experimental and Cognitive Psychology, having authored 67 papers that have together received 1.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Psychotherapy Techniques and Applications (20 papers), Obsessive-Compulsive Spectrum Disorders (15 papers), Sexuality, Behavior, and Technology (11 papers), Mental Health Treatment and Access (10 papers), Personality Disorders and Psychopathology (10 papers), Posttraumatic Stress Disorder Research (6 papers),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(6 papers) and Mental Health Research Topics (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Clinical Psychology (1.2k citations), Applied Psychology (146 citations), Social Psychology (532 citations), Health (181 citations) and Experimental and Cognitive Psychology (235 citations). Stephen M. Saunders has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and Philippines. Frequent co-authors include Kenneth I. Howard, S. Mark Kopta, Robert W. Blum, Michael D. Resnick, Harry M. Hoberman, Kenneth I. Pargäment, Wolfgang Lutz, Zoran Martinovich, David E. Orlinsky and Megan Petrik.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Psychology, Psychotherapy, Psychological Assessment, Behaviour Research and Therapy and Psychology of Addictive Behaviors.
